Today, due the minute participation of Smalltalk in world production of new funcionality, you cannot find in any commercial or publicly available database on productivity (like ISBSG http://www.isbsg.org/) it mentioned by itself, but only lumped as OTHER 4GL).
For a more or less uptodate and public reference, give a look at http://www.qsm.com/?q=resources/function-point-languages-table/index.html
WTF. From the page:
What is a gearing factor? The gearing factor is simply the average number of Source Lines of Code (SLOC) per function point in the completed project. It is calculated by dividing the final code count for a completed project by the final function point count. SLOC counts are logical, not physical line counts.
Nuts, is this how the *enterprise* projects are evaluated? That is absolute non-sense. What is the difference between logical and physical line counts?
The main point of the text you read is that the evaluations should be done asap in IFPUG Funtion Points or similar metric. The proviso thy put there is to allow different coding practices to be accomodated without inflating the outcomes. A lot of languages allow more than a logical statement to put in a single line, or for aesthetical reasons break a single statement in more than a single line.
